Why Live in Worthington

Worthington, also known as Worthington Farms, is a peaceful suburban neighborhood in Richmond’s South Side. This established area features small ranch-style and split-level homes built in the 1950s and '60s, typically three-bedroom brick or brick-and-vinyl structures on lots of a half-acre or less. Residents appreciate the neighborhood for its aesthetics, affordability, and proximity to city amenities. Worthington is 10 miles from downtown Richmond and 7 miles from Chesterfield Towne Center, with Forest Hill Park just 4 miles away. The neighborhood is solely residential, providing a quiet retreat from nearby highways and commercial spaces. Local highlights include Powhite Park, a 100-acre wooded area with trails and a small beach, and Forest Hill Park, known for its historic Stone House, playground, and year-round farmers market. Worthington is close to major thoroughfares like Route 60 and Route 360, offering access to a variety of stores and dining options, including local favorite Abuelita’s. Community events are frequently held at the Broad Rock Branch of Richmond’s Public Library, located 3 miles away. Public transportation is accessible via Greater Richmond Transit Company buses, and essential services like Chippenham Hospital and the Central Virginia VA Health Care System are within a 3-mile radius. Worthington’s crime rate is lower than the national average, contributing to its appeal as a residential area.
